In the last three days, 32 patients have died, including three newborn babies, as a result of the siege of the hospital and lack of power, according to spokesman for the Hamas-run Health Ministry in Gaza Ashraf Al-Qidra, who was inside Al-Shifa Hospital.
At least 650 patients were still inside, desperate to be evacuated to another medical facility.
Israel says the hospital sits atop tunnels housing a headquarters for Hamas fighters using patients as shields, which Hamas denies.
Israel launched its campaign last month to annihilate Hamas, the militant group that runs the Gaza Strip, after Hamas gunmen rampaged through southern Israel killing civilians.
Around 1,200 people died and 240 were dragged to Gaza as hostages, according to Israel’s tally.
Gaza medical authorities say more than 11,000 people have been confirmed killed, around 40 per cent of them children.
Israel says it must destroy Hamas and that the blame for harm to civilians falls on fighters hiding among them.
